Abstract

A semiconductor device has a via-contact, a main wire having an end connected to the via-contact, and an extension extended in line with the main wire from the end of the main wire beyond the via-contact, the width of the extension being equal to or narrower than the width of the main wire. The extension prevents the end of the main wire from being rounded by an optical proximity effect, eliminates a contact defect or an open defect between the via-contact and the end of the main wire, and involves no widening of the main wire around the via-contact, so that other via-contacts may be arranged in the vicinity of the via-contact in question without violating design rules.
